Ealing campaigners call for more support for the NHS

NHS campaigners on Saturday (9 March 2024) have raised awareness in Ealing to residents of Restore Our NHS action day.

A number of stalls, including one outside Ealing Town Hall, popped up across Ealing Broadway to raise awareness by Ealing Save Our NHS which supports Keep Our NHS Public.

Oliver New, chair of Ealing Save Our NHS said: “Our NHS is a vital part of our lives; we all need it, starting from birth. It’s imperative that the NHS is funded to work properly, not underfunded to fail. In Ealing and elsewhere, pretty much all sections of the NHS, from A&Es to maternity to dentistry to GPs, are under-resourced in recent years and staff put under an unacceptable level of pressure”

Mr New added: “We have seen an constant flow of re-organisation and restructuring of the NHS, all aimed at reducing costs, but it usually making things worse for the NHS staff and easier for private companies to draw on scarce NHS resources. People are increasing forced to pay for operations, for mental health support and for private dentistry, all of which takes away NHS trained staff and leaves behind those who can’t afford to pay.”

Campaigners also raised awareness to local residents about recent plans by NHS North West London to implement a controversial decision that was set to see same day GP appointments be moved from surgeries and on to telephone hubs, mainly staffed by non-doctors.

This decision by NHS North West London has now been postponed following objections from campaigners, patient groups and GPs themselves.

Saturday’s protests in Ealing called on political leaders of all parties to commit to restoring more funding for the NHS and seeking an end to privatisation.

Mr New added: “Most shoppers certainly understand that their NHS needs proper funding and not privatisation.”
